Written for young adults, the Urban Underground series confronts issues that are of great importance to teens, such as friendship, loyalty, drugs, gangs, abuse, urban blight, bullies, and self-esteem to name a few. More than entertainment, these books can be a powerful learning and coping tool when a struggling reader connects with credible characters and a compelling storyline. The highly readable style and mature topics will appeal to young adult readers of both sexes and encourage them to finish each eBook. Cesar Chavez HS Series - Everyone's a little nervous after a drive-by in the barrio. But then comes news of another shooting, and it hits very close to home for Ernesto Sandoval. After Naomi's neighbor and fellow senior, Roxie Torres, is shot, a homeless drifter is arrested. But Ernesto thinks Roxie is a liar.
